Company & Position Overview:

J.B. Poindexter & Co., Inc. (JBPCO) is a privately held, diversified manufacturing company forecasting over $2.5B in annual revenues and employing over 8,000 team members. The six operating subsidiaries, covering 60 locations, are engaged in the production of commercial truck bodies, step-vans, utility trucks, ambulances, electric and alternative fuel vehicles, and expandable foam plastic packaging. The Safety Program Manager will develop, coordinate, and implement occupational health and safety policies, procedures, and training to promote and ensure effective safety operations across the organization and lead our internal audit program. This role requires a strong background in occupational health and safety, risk management, and compliance, along with exceptional management and communication skills.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
  • Establish safety policies and procedures. Design and implement standardized safety policies and procedures that comply with relevant laws, regulations, and industry best practices; ensure these policies are effectively communicated and consistently followed throughout the organization.
  • Develop a corporate safety and communications calendar, develop and deliver content to all business units.
  • Build a robust company-wide ergonomics program through partnership with 3rd party solutions and company medical staff.
  • Monitor and assess safety performance. Regularly analyze safety data to identify trends, potential hazards, and emerging risks.
  • Foster a culture of safety excellence by promoting accountability, continuous improvement, and employee engagement.
  • Develop a safety strategy to incorporate HOP and VPP elements.
  • Participate in company internal EHS audits and inspections.
  • Develop and deliver safety training programs. Collaborate with training and development teams to design and deliver effective safety training programs for employees (at all levels), contractors, and onsite service providers; ensure that employees are adequately trained to perform their duties safely.
  • Stay informed about industry trends and regulations. Stay up to date with the latest safety regulations, industry trends, and emerging technologies related to workplace safety, and proactively identify (and implement) opportunities to provide best-in-class safety practices.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ams. Foster strong relationships with key stakeholders, including leadership, operations, human resources, legal, and risk management teams; work collaboratively to ensure safety considerations are integrated into business processes and decision-making.
  • Assist with coordinating company-wide programs, such as machine guarding, combustible dust, and industrial hygiene.
  • Partner with all business units and procurement to select vendors and implement company-wide service agreements (i.e., arc flash, PPE vendors, etc.)
